Frequently Asked Questions
The average net price at Columbia University in the City of New York is $22,000 per year, compared to $29,980 at Macalester College. Columbia University in the City of New York is $7,980 less expensive on average after financial aid.
Admitted students at Columbia University in the City of New York typically score between 1510-1580 on the SAT (25th-75th percentile). At Macalester College, the typical SAT range is 1350-1510. Scoring within or above these ranges will make you a competitive applicant.
Columbia University in the City of New York has a graduation rate of 92%, while Macalester College has a graduation rate of 90%. Columbia University in the City of New York has the higher graduation rate, indicating strong student support and retention.
Columbia University in the City of New York has a student-to-faculty ratio of 6:1, while Macalester College has a ratio of 10:1. Columbia University in the City of New York offers smaller class sizes on average, which typically means more individual attention from professors.
At Columbia University in the City of New York, 52% of students receive financial aid with an average grant of $67,010. At Macalester College, 87% of students receive aid with an average grant of $42,766.
The median earnings for Columbia University in the City of New York graduates 10 years after enrollment is $102,491, compared to $63,878 for Macalester College graduates. Graduates from Columbia University in the City of New York tend to earn more on average, though individual outcomes vary by major and career path.
